Building Plot in Sapporo's Hachiken District
This is a vacant plot of land located in the Hachiken area of Nishi Ward, Sapporo, Hokkaido. The property has a surveyed land area of 389.00 square meters, or approximately 117.67 tsubo. The land is classified as miscellaneous land (zakkichi) and is situated within an urbanization promotion area. The zoning designation is Category 2 Medium-to-High-Rise Exclusive Residential District, with a maximum building coverage ratio of 60% and a floor area ratio of 200%. The site is flat and level, making it suitable for construction.
The property benefits from utility connections including city gas, a public water supply, a public sewer system, and electricity. The road frontage details indicate the lot faces a single public road to the southwest, which is 8 meters wide, with a frontage of 4 meters. Legal restrictions include an 18-meter height control zone and a landscape planning area.
The location is convenient, being a 10-minute walk from Hachiken Station on the Sassho Line. Other nearby stations include Shinkawa Station (15 minutes on foot) and Kotoni Station on the Hakodate Main Line (20 minutes on foot). A JR bus stop is also a 4-minute walk away. The property is considered ideal for a single-family home or apartment development. The current status is raw land with no existing structures, and delivery timing is negotiable.
